Spinal cord injury

Overview

A traumatic spinal cord injury may happen because of a sudden blow or cut to the spine.

Symptoms

A spinal cord injury often causes permanent loss of strength, sensation, and function below the site of the injury.

Treatments

Rehabilitation and assistive devices allow many people with spinal cord injuries to lead productive, independent lives. Treatments include drugs to reduce symptoms and surgery to stabilize the spine.
